OpenAI Sets Its Sights on Historic Fundraising
OpenAI Aims to Raise Billions, Eyes Sky-High $750 Billion Valuation!
OpenAI is in preliminary talks to raise tens of billions, potentially valuing the company at a staggering $750 billion. This comes after a recent valuation at $500 billion from a secondary share sale. As OpenAI solidifies its dominance in the AI landscape, questions arise about sustainability amid high burn rates. The company aims for aggressive growth, backed by key partnerships and market confidence.
